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0100629699 11695 56 08548040 9455336
7121005276 3829 6803101
7121005276 3829 6803101
9664 5935148 367536348
All about undefined
Interested in learning more?
7121005276 3829 6803101
9664 5935148 367536348
See more
994608 564
53696282475 2307797971 27403
See more
499556267 935906570 6484991
77216489321 3230264 793530403
See more